Tostones (Twice-Fried Green Plantains)
Side DishDominican Republic

TostonesTwice-Fried Green Plantains

Green plantains are fried, flattened, and fried again until crisp outside and tender inside. Served with a simple garlicky dipping sauce, they make a bold and satisfying side dish.

Ingredients

Quantities update automatically when you change the serving size.

4

Plantains

  • 800g
    Plantain (peeled and cut into thick rounds)
  • 400ml
    Vegetable Oil
  • 6g
    Salt

Dip

  • 10g
    Garlic (minced)
  • 200ml
    Water
  • 20ml
    Distilled White Vinegar

Cook through it

Method

Follow each step in order. Ingredient names are highlighted as you go.

5 steps
  1. 01

    Heat the vegetable oil to 175°C (350°F). Fry the plantain for 3 to 4 minutes, until pale golden and just tender, then drain.

  2. 02

    Flatten each piece of plantain into a thick disc.

  3. 03

    Return the flattened plantain to the hot vegetable oil and fry for 2 to 3 minutes, until crisp and deep golden. Drain and sprinkle with the salt.

  4. 04

    Stir the garlic, water, and distilled white vinegar together until combined.

  5. 05

    Serve the hot plantains with the dipping sauce on the side.
